Garage Door Damage After Severe Weather in Northwest Arkansas
Storm damage in NWA often shows up in ways that are not always obvious at first glance. Some issues are visible immediately, while others develop over time as damaged components continue to operate under stress.
Common Types of Storm Related Garage Door Damage
- Wind damaged garage doors – Strong winds can cause garage doors to bow inward or flex beyond their design limits. This often leads to misaligned tracks, bent panels, or compromised rollers. Even if the door still opens, hidden stress can lead to failure later.
- Debris impact on garage door panels – Branches, roofing materials, and loose objects can strike panels with enough force to dent steel, crack composites, or break windows. Damage may appear cosmetic, but it can weaken the door structure.
- Water intrusion and moisture exposure – Heavy rain and flooding can damage bottom seals, tracks, and hardware. Moisture accelerates corrosion and can damage sensors, springs, and opener components.
- Power disruptions affecting openers – Storms often cause outages or electrical surges that disrupt garage door openers. This can lead to the opener not responding, partial operation, or complete failure.

Storm Damage in Northwest Arkansas and Garage Door Weak Points
Garage doors are complex systems with multiple moving parts. Storms tend to exploit the weakest points first, especially on older or poorly maintained doors.
Areas Most Likely to Fail During Severe Weather
- Panels and hinges – Panels that are already weakened by age or prior dents are more likely to buckle under wind pressure. Hinges may crack or loosen under sudden force.
- Tracks and mounting brackets – High winds can push doors out of alignment. Once tracks bend or shift, the door may jam or come off the track entirely.
- Springs and cables – Storm stress can increase strain on springs and cables, especially if the door becomes unbalanced. Damaged springs create serious safety hazards.
- Garage door openers – Torsion system issues can place extra strain on motors and sensors, reducing opener lifespan and reliability.

Protecting Garage Doors from Storm Damage in NWA
Protecting garage doors from storm damage in NWA is about preparation and reinforcement. Homeowners who take proactive steps are far less likely to experience emergency failures during storm season.
Effective Storm Damage Prevention Steps
- Reinforce door panels – Installing bracing systems or upgrading to wind rated doors helps prevent bowing and collapse during high wind events.
- Secure tracks and hardware – Tightening mounting brackets and reinforcing track supports improves resistance against wind pressure and vibration.
- Check balance and spring tension – Spring tension directly affects the balance and movement of modern overhead garage doors. A balanced door resists storm stress better and operates more safely.
- Upgrade weather seals – Quality bottom seals and perimeter weather stripping reduce water intrusion and protect internal components.
- Inspect opener settings – Ensuring sensors and force settings are calibrated helps prevent damage if resistance occurs during storms.
